Did you know...

We​ are all entitled to human rights across the globe however, women and girls still face gender discrimination.

  • In over 70 countries, women hold no property or inheritance rights.

  • 6% of black women travel globally.

  • 27.8% of the U.S. House of Representatives are women. WOMEN NEED A VOICE

  • 88% of women said they compare themselves to images in the media.

  • 8% of Fortune 500 CEO's are women with only 2 being black women.

  • 12.8% of the U.S. population is Black while 2.4% of U.S. businesses are black-owned. 72% of the U.S. population is White while 86.5% of U.S. businesses are white-owned.

  • 74% of women stated they undergo work-related stress vs. 61% of males.
